PTA团队天梯赛 L1-022 奇偶分家
时间复杂度为O(n)
#include<stdio.h>
#include<stdlib.h>
int main(){
int n,jishu = 0,oushu = 0; //数字总数n,奇数个数jishu,偶数个数oushu
scanf("%d",&n);
int *a = (int*)malloc(n*4); //动态分配类型为int,长度为n的数组
int i;
for(i = 0;i < n;i++){
scanf("%d",&a[i]);
}
for(i = 0;i < n;i++){
if(a[i] % 2 == 0){
oushu++;
}
else{
jishu++;
}
}
printf("%d %d",jishu,oushu);
return 0;
}